How do you take a front rotor off a 1988 ford bronco 2?
To remove the front rotor from a 1988 Ford Bronco II, first, lift the vehicle and secure it on jack stands. Remove the wheel and tire, then disconnect the brake caliper by unbolting it and suspending it safely without stressing the brake line. Next, remove the rotor by either unscrewing any retaining screws if present or gently tapping it off the hub, ensuring to check for rust or debris that may be holding it in place. Finally, replace it with the new rotor and reassemble the components in reverse order.

What is the bolt pattern for a 2004 350z?
The bolt pattern for a 2004 Nissan 350Z is 5x114.3 mm. This means there are five bolt holes, and the distance between the centers of two opposite holes is 114.3 mm. Additionally, the thread size for the lug nuts is typically M12x1.25.

How do you test the fuel pressure regulator on a 1987 Volvo 740 gle non turbo?
To test the fuel pressure regulator on a 1987 Volvo 740 GLE non-turbo, first, relieve the fuel system pressure by removing the fuel pump fuse and running the engine until it stalls. Then, disconnect the vacuum line from the regulator and check for fuel presence in the hose, which indicates a faulty regulator. Next, connect a fuel pressure gauge to the fuel rail's test port and compare the reading to the manufacturer's specifications; it should typically be around 36-42 psi. If the pressure is outside this range or the regulator leaks fuel, it needs replacement.

Car heater blowing cold air no fuses blown?
If your car heater is blowing cold air despite no blown fuses, it could be due to low coolant levels, which can prevent the heater core from receiving hot coolant. Another possibility is a malfunctioning thermostat that isn't allowing the engine to reach the proper operating temperature. Additionally, there may be an issue with the heater core itself, such as a blockage or leak. Checking coolant levels and inspecting the thermostat and heater core are good next steps for troubleshooting.
